How to Prolong Your Rechargeable Battery Life

Image
Prolong Your Laptop Battery Life 1. Avoid deep discharge and instead, try to charge your laptop battery more often between uses. The smaller the depth of discharge, the longer the battery will last. 2. Avoid storing the battery in full discharged state. As the battery will self-discharge overtime, its voltage will gradually lower, and when it is depleted below the low-voltage threshold (2.4 to 2.9 V/cell, depending on chemistry) it cannot be charged anymore because the protection circuit (a type of electronic fuse) disables it. Rechargeable Laptop Battery 3. Lithium-ion batterie s should be kept cool; they may be stored in a refrigerator if deemed necessary. The rate of degradation of Lithium-ion batteries is strongly temperature-dependent; they degrade much faster if stored or used at higher temperatures. 4.
